Abstract

提供一种制备纳米二氧化钛的方法,包括如下步骤:(1)利用盐酸将钛铁矿粉进行溶解,以获得原矿溶液;(2)去除所述原矿溶液中的铁元素,以获得含有钛离子的最终溶液;(3)对所述最终溶液进行加热水解,以获得包括二氧化钛的水解产物;(4)对获得的水解产物进行煅烧,获得纳米二氧化钛。该方法原料易得、能耗低,既可生产金红石型也可生产锐钛型二氧化钛,产物纯度高、粒径小,粒径分布范围小,分散性好。

Description

制备纳米二氧化钛的方法 技术领域
本发明属于无机功能材料制备技术领域,具体是一种制备纳米二氧化钛的方法。
背景技术
二氧化钛具有稳定的物理性能、化学性能和优良的光学、电学性能,以及优良的颜料性能,用途十分广泛。涂料、塑料、橡胶、化纤、造纸、油墨、化妆品、玩具、电容器、显像管、国防尖端技术、食品、医药、化学试剂、电焊条、搪瓷、陶瓷、玻璃、耐火材料、冶金、人造宝石、美术颜料、皮革、印染色浆、肥皂、催化剂等都要用到二氧化钛。
目前,制备二氧化钛的方法主要有氯化法和硫酸法。
氯化法技术先进,流程短,易于实现自动化,产品质量好。但氯化法对原料品位要求高,需使用金红石矿做原料,而金红石矿属于稀缺资源。除此之外,氯化法技术难度大,利用氯化法制备二氧化钛时,需要利用高温下耐四氯化钛、氯气、氧气的材料和设备,这种材料和设备投资费用高,维修困难。
硫酸法原料便宜,工艺成熟,设备简单,但工艺流程长,能耗高,三废排放多,产品质量差。
目前,国内生产二氧化钛产能在3~15万吨/年的企业有47家,总产能为350万吨/年,其中,采用氯化法生产二氧化钛的企业只有一家,其它企业均采用硫酸法生产二氧化钛。但是,这些企业产能过剩,处于保本或亏损状态。
如何以较低的成本获得高品质的纳米二氧化钛为本领域亟待解决的技术问题。
发明内容
本发明提供一种制备纳米二氧化钛的方法,该方法可以以较低的成本获得高品质的纳米二氧化钛。高纯度金红石型或锐钛型纳米二氧化钛的方法,以钛铁矿为原料,经盐酸溶矿,结晶氯化亚铁,氧化,溶剂萃取除铁,胶凝除硅,热水解,得到高纯度的金红石型或锐钛型纳米二氧化钛,粒径在10~40nm
为了实现上述目的,本发明提供一种制备纳米二氧化钛的方法,其中,包括如下步骤:
(1)利用盐酸将钛铁矿粉进行溶解,以获得原矿溶液;
(2)去除所述原矿溶液中的铁元素,以获得含有钛离子的最终溶液;
(3)对所述最终溶液进行加热水解,以获得包括二氧化钛的水解产物;
(4)对获得的水解产物进行煅烧,获得纳米二氧化钛。
容易理解的是,所述步骤(1)为溶矿步骤。在本发明中,用盐酸溶矿,可以获得四氯化钛,四氯化钛加热水解可以获得二氧化钛。水解获得的二氧化钛经煅烧后,非常容易破碎分散,从而可以获得纳米二氧化钛粉末。利用本发明所提供的方法,对设备要求不高,而且可以获得高纯度、高品位的纳米二氧化钛粉末。
在本发明中,对步骤(1)中的矿酸比(即,钛铁矿粉末的重量与盐酸的重量之比)的具体值没有特殊的要求,足量的盐酸可提高溶矿率和溶矿速度,同时防止溶矿过程中钛的水解,以保证钛的溶出率。作为本发明的一种具体实施方式,可通过钛铁矿中酸可溶物及所消耗的氯化氢量、溶矿终了时所期望的钛液中盐酸的浓度进行计算,一般期望最终有约9mol/L的盐酸。也就是说,盐酸的质量浓度为30%~38%。
如果钛铁矿粉中铁的含量过高,高的酸度会使氯化铁在溶矿过程中析出,这样会减慢溶出速度,也会使析出的氯化铁过滤除去。因此,钛铁矿的 组成、酸浓度、浸出温度要综合考虑。一般矿酸比在1:3~4,溶矿温度在60~100℃,溶矿时间在4~6小时。
钛铁矿粉的粒度越小,则溶矿时的溶解速率越高,优选地,钛铁矿粉的粒径可以为300μm,在这种情况下,溶矿率可达90%以上。
如果使用浓度较低的盐酸,也可采用多次溶矿的方式,以达到预期的浸出率。
为了节约成本,可以将本发明中的盐酸回收。回收的盐酸经过氯化氢增浓后,可以在下一轮制备纳米二氧化钛粉末的过程中重新使用。
在本发明中,对除去原矿溶液中铁元素的具体方法也没有特殊的要求,只要能够将原矿中铁元素去除,从而不残留在最终获得的纳米二氧化钛粉末中即可。由于在步骤(1)中,利用盐酸在60~100℃进行溶矿,因此,在原矿溶液中存在亚铁离子,为了节约成本,可以通过冷却的方法去除铁元素。具体地,步骤(2)可以包括:
(2a)结晶氯化亚铁:对所述步骤(1)中得到的所述原矿溶液进行冷却,获得结晶四水合氯化亚铁,过滤分离所述结晶四水合氯化亚铁,得到第一溶液;
(2b)氧化:将所述第一溶液中残存的氯化亚铁氧化为氯化铁,获得第二溶液;
(2c)萃取:对所述第二溶液进行溶剂萃取,得到含铁离子的反萃液和含钛离子的萃余液;
(2d)除硅:去除所述萃余液中的硅,以获得所述最终溶液。
钛铁矿中一般含有二价铁和三价铁,所以原矿溶液中含有二价和三价铁离子。为了减少步骤(2c)中溶剂萃取负荷,在步骤(2a)中已经将大部分二价铁结晶除去。将原矿溶液冷却至0~4摄氏度即可使四水合氯化亚铁结晶析出,在本发明中,为了便于描述,将经过步骤(2a)后获得的溶液称为第一溶液。通过过滤可以分离第一溶液中的结晶四水合氯化亚铁。在步骤 (2a)中,适当注入氯化氢提高盐酸的浓度可使二价铁最大程度结晶,对结晶得到的结晶四水合氯化亚铁进行较高温度的水解可得到盐酸和铁的氧化物。对获得盐酸通入氯化氢增浓后,可以用于下一轮纳米二氧化钛粉末的制备工艺,水解获得的铁的氧化物可用作钢厂炼钢的原料。由此可知,利用本发明所提供的方法制备纳米二氧化钛还可以降低制备成本。
优选地,在所述步骤(2a)中,将所述步骤(1)中的得到的所述原矿溶液冷却至0~4℃。
结晶氯化亚铁后的第一溶液中仍含有少量二价铁,可以将其氧化为三价铁,然后通过萃取的方法从第一溶液中去除,以获得第二溶液。在步骤(2b)中,可选择的氧化试剂可以是氯气、双氧水和氯酸钠中的任意一种。为使萃取较为完全,二价铁氧化完全程度是重要的,氧化程度可通过在线检测控制实现。
通过选择步骤2(c)中萃取剂的类型和萃取的次数可以控制步骤(4)中所获得的纳米二氧化钛粉末的类型。经过萃取,可以将钛元素与铁元素分离。
利用萃取剂对所述第二溶液进行萃取,得到含有三价铁离子的反萃液和含有钛离子的萃余液。
因为步骤(2c)中所用到的萃取过程属于溶剂萃取,因此,萃取剂的选择及组成是重要的,其对萃取容量、选择性、分层速度有较大影响。另外萃取温度会导致萃取油相的粘度变化,对萃取剂的萃取容量、分离因数、分层速度影响显著,一般萃取温度应在30摄氏度。萃取段的油水比可选择1~2。
萃取剂的成分可以决定最终获得的纳米二氧化钛粉末的类型。例如,当萃取剂为含有胺类萃取剂的有机油相时,经过一次3~3级的连续萃取可以获得金红石型二氧化钛。
经过步骤(3)中的水解步骤之后,获得的已经是金红石型二氧化钛。经步骤(4)中的煅烧,可脱除分子间水,并且可以去除残余的氯,从而可 以得到不含水、不含氯的纳米二氧化钛粉末。在这种实施方式中获得的金红石型二氧化钛纯度可达99.5%,金红石型纳米二氧化钛的粒径为10~40nm。
作为本发明的一种优选实施方式,所述胺类萃取剂为叔胺,其通式是R1R2R3N,其中R1、R2、R3为具有8~10个碳原子的直链或支链的烃基。
含有胺类萃取剂的有机油相中除了包括所述胺类萃取剂之外,还可以包括稀释剂。所述稀释剂可选择煤油或醇类溶剂,进一步地,醇类溶剂可选择辛醇或癸醇,各组分的比例具有较宽的适用范围,并非是苛刻的。
在含钛离子的萃余相中,除含钛离子、少量铁离子之外尚含一些其它影响水解产物纯度的组分,如硅、磷等。
优选地,所述步骤(2)还可以包括:(2d)除硅:去除所述萃余液中的硅,以获得所述最终溶液。其中的硅可通过胶凝的方法使其凝聚,然后滤除,从而可以得到所述最终溶液。
通过调整步骤(2c),可以在步骤(4)中获得锐钛型二氧化钛粉末。具体地,所述步骤(2c)可以包括:
(2c1)一次溶剂萃取:将氧化后的钛液,用含有胺类萃取剂的有机油相进行3~5级连续萃取,得到含有三价铁离子的反萃液和含有钛离子的萃余液;
(2c2)二次溶剂萃取:一次溶剂萃取所得含有钛离子的萃余液,用含有机磷萃取剂的油相进行二次萃取,萃取过程为3~5级连续萃取,得到油相的含钛离子的萃余液和水相的含有盐酸的反萃液。
在这种实施方式中,步骤(2c1)与制备红金石型二氧化钛粉末中的步骤(2c)是相同的,这里不再赘述。在步骤(2d)中,除去所述步骤(2c2)中获得的含钛离子的萃余液中的硅。
在步骤(2c2)中,所述有机磷萃取剂为有机磷化合物或有机磷化合物的混合物,其通式为R1R2R3PO,其中R1、R2、R3为直链或支链的烃基,R1、R2、R3的碳原子之和大于12。容易理解的是,在步骤(2c2)中,含有机磷 萃取剂的油相还包括稀释剂,所述稀释剂可选择煤油或醇类溶剂,进一步地,醇类溶剂可选择辛醇或癸醇,各组分的比例具有较宽的适用范围,并非是苛刻的。
在步骤(2c2)中获得的含有盐酸的水相增浓后,可以用于下一轮制备纳米二氧化钛粉末中的溶矿步骤,从而可以降低生产成本。
对步骤(2c2)中获得的含钛离子的萃余液进行水解后,可以获得锐钛型二氧化钛。经煅烧后,可以获得纯度为99.8~99.9%、粒径为10~40nm的锐钛型二氧化钛粉末。
在对所述最终溶液进行加热水解的步骤(3)中,需要对所述最终溶液的酸度进行调整,然后再加热水解。
具体地,步骤(3)可以包括:
(3a)对步骤(2d)中获得的所述最终溶液进行加热水解,水解温度可以为80~110℃;
(3b)对所述步骤(3a)中获得的水解产物进行酸洗和无离子水洗涤,以获得二氧化钛粉末。
在步骤(3a)中的水解结束后,过滤可以得到水解产物二氧化钛和低浓度盐酸。此步骤中获得的低浓度盐酸经氯化氢增浓后用于下一轮纳米二氧化钛粉末的制备工艺中的溶矿步骤。
经过步骤(3a)后,经过滤得到的水解产物,该水解产物携带一定量的水解母液,将其中杂质留存于水解产物中。为了去除水解产物中的杂质,在步骤(3b)中,对所述水解产物进行洗涤。在本发明中,可用稀盐酸、无离子水梯次洗涤,以最大限度减少洗涤液的用量。
在步骤(3)开始之前,需要对所述最终溶液进行精滤,以防所述最终溶液中存在的其它悬浮物形成结晶中心影响二氧化钛的结晶质量。
为了适应对产物的质量要求,可以适当的控制水解条件,例如,有时需要对所述最终溶液进行浓缩。
水解的方式可选用蒸发水解、控制温度加热水解等方式。
水解条件对水解产物的质量影响显著,其中,影响水解产物的质量的水解条件主要包括酸度、最终溶液中钛离子的浓度、水解温度、升温速度、水解保温时间、晶种数量及质量。在本发明中,可根据对产物质量的不同要求对上述水解条件进行选择性地控制。
本方法采用自生晶种强制加热水解的方式进行所述步骤(3),通过对其它条件的调整来控制最终获得的纳米二氧化钛粉末的质量。一般可进行回流水解,最终溶液的临界水解温度对水解产物的质量非常重要。
为了获得干燥的纳米二氧化钛粉末,优选地,所述步骤(4)可以包括:
(4a)将步骤(3)中获得的二氧化钛粉末进行干燥,干燥温度为200~300℃;
(4b)将步骤(4a)中获得的产物进行煅烧,煅烧温度为700~800℃。
以上水解产物已是金红石型纳米二氧化钛或锐钛型纳米二氧化钛,但仍需进行干燥、煅烧的步骤。
经200~300℃干燥后,可脱除水解获得的二氧化钛粉末中的分子间水,到不含水的二氧化钛。煅烧会使干燥后的二氧化钛粉末的粒径变大,但在一定温度范围内并不显著,过高的煅烧温度会导致粒子烧结,因此,必须严格控制煅烧温度。优选地,在步骤(4b)中,煅烧温度为800~900℃,既可以防止纳米二氧化钛颗粒过度长大或烧结,又可使纳米二氧化钛粉末中的氯含量降低。
当然,所述步骤(4)还可以包括直接对步骤(3)中获得的产物进行煅烧,煅烧温度为800~900℃。
为了获得分散性良好的纳米二氧化钛粉末,优选地,所述方法还可以包括:(5)对所述步骤(4)中获得的产物进行粉碎,以获得分散的纳米二氧化钛粉末。
步骤(4)中获得的产物极易粉碎,粉碎后得到分散性好的二氧化钛。
本方法的优点是:
1.原料易得,甚至可用低品位的钛铁矿,此种矿用于炼铁,由于钛的存在,造成高炉炉壁结瘤,无法使用,本发明的方法则可使用,该矿石价格仅是正常钛铁矿的二分之一;
2.能耗低,生产过程采用相对低的反应温度,在100℃以下;
3.既可生产金红石型也可生产锐钛型二氧化钛,不须煅烧直接水解即可得到金红石型产物;
4.产物纯度高,可达到99.5%~99.9%;
5.粒径小,粒径分布范围小,分散性好;
6.反应条件温和,生产容易控制;
7.设备简单,投资费用低;
8.溶矿滤渣用于建筑材料,分离出的氯化铁经水解回收盐酸,得到的氧化铁用于集团公司钢厂作原料,其它物料实现循环,无排放;
9.本方法显著优点之一是使用氯化氢,提高了溶矿的浸出率,达到98%,同时增浓过程中回收的低浓度盐酸,使之充分利用;
10.本方法的另一显著特征是,溶剂萃取的应用纯化了钛液,使二氧化钛具有更好的纯度。本方法经过中试生产,证明可行,优势明显。

具体实施方式
以下结合附图对本发明的具体实施方式进行详细说明。应当理解的是,此处所描述的具体实施方式仅用于说明和解释本发明,并不用于限制本发明。
实施例1:
(1)在1000L搪玻璃反应釜中投入200公斤粒径为200目的钛铁矿粉,加入31%的盐酸800公斤,关闭反应釜,利用蒸汽夹套加热至100℃,搅拌溶解4小时,然后夹套冷却水降温至30摄氏度,经密封无泄漏式板框过滤器过滤,得到清澈透明的原矿溶液,经检测及物料平衡计算,其中钛离子浓度65.33克/升,总铁离子55.88克/升,其中,二价铁离子41.39克/升,钛溶出率94.21%,铁溶出率95.23%;
(2)去除所述原矿溶液中的铁元素,以获得含有钛离子的最终溶液,具体包括:
(2a)将上述原矿溶液冷却至0℃,进行结晶,然后滤除四水合氯化亚铁,获得第一溶液;
(2b)利用计算量氯气对所述第一溶液进行氧化,搅拌加热至60℃,以将二价铁氧化完全并去除残余氯,还原进一步消除残余氯,并降温至室温,获得第二溶液,该第二溶液中的铁离子为三价铁离子;
(2c)利用含有胺类萃取剂的有机油相对所述第二溶液进行三级连续萃取和反萃,得到含三价铁离子的反萃液和含钛离子的萃余液;
(2d)对萃余液进行搅拌下加入阴离子高分子絮凝剂,然后对萃余液进 行精滤,得到最终溶液,在所述最终溶液中,钛离子浓度为62.05克/升,三价铁离子0.40克/升,酸浓度6.66mol/L;
(3)对所述最终溶液进行加热水解,以获得包括二氧化钛的水解产物,具体包括:
(3a)加热强制回流水解,水解温度为85℃,水解时间3小时,降温,取样测得水解率为97%;
(3b)将水解产物滤出,然后利用稀盐酸对水解产物进行洗涤,再利用无离子水对稀盐酸洗涤后的水解产物进行二次洗涤;
(4)将步骤(3b)中洗涤后的水解产物在900℃下煅烧2小时;
(5)将步骤(4)中的煅烧产物破碎。
其中,含有胺类萃取剂的有机油相组分为:叔胺/辛醇/煤油=45wt%:5wt%:50wt%。
实施例2
利用实施例1中的步骤制备纳米二氧化钛粉末,不同之处在于,在步骤(2c)包括:
(2c1)利用含有胺类萃取剂的有机油对所述第二溶液进行三级连续萃取,以获得含有三价铁离子的反萃液和含有钛离子的萃余液;
(2c2)二次溶剂萃取:利用含有机磷萃取剂的油相对所述步骤(2c1)中获得的含有钛离子的萃余液进行二次萃取,萃取过程为三级连续萃取,得到油相的含钛离子的萃余液和水相的含有盐酸的反萃液;
(2c3)对所述萃取油相进行洗涤,以进一步除去杂质,再进行五级反萃,随后精滤,滤除杂质后得到含钛离子的最终溶液。经检测,所述最终溶液中钛离子浓度33.02克/升,未检测到三价铁离子,酸浓度6.62mol/L。
在所述步骤(3)中,水解温度为90摄氏度,水解时间3小时,降温。取样测定水解率为98%。
其中,步骤(2c1)中,含有胺类萃取剂的有机油相的组分为:叔胺/辛醇/煤油=45wt%:5wt%:50wt%。在步骤(2c2)中,含有机磷萃取剂的油相的组分为:有机磷萃取剂/辛醇/煤油=20wt%:15wt%:65wt%。
将上述例中结晶的氯化亚铁结晶与一次萃取的反萃液(含三价铁的溶液)混合,得到的溶液中含有二价铁20.3克/升,总铁42.15克/升,钛0.5克/升,进行蒸馏热水解,得到固体氧化铁,气相经冷却收集,得到16%的盐酸。
检测例1
实施1中,利用XRD检测二氧化钛纯度99.52%,成分分析见表1中实施例1,实施例1中的纳米二氧化钛粉末的物相为金红石型,在扫描电镜图片中观测到纳米二氧化钛的粒径在10nm左右,见附图1、2。
检测例2
实施例2中,利用XRD检测二氧化钛纯度99.91%,成分分析见表1中实施例2,实施例2中纳米二氧化钛粉末的物相为锐钛型,在扫描电镜图片中观测到纳米二氧化钛的粒径在10nm左右,见附图3、4。
